Output 150c869af1bebb8aed780fcd347caa2d328836a9caeddc8525fce54b3d412aaf:110

value
42253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dbe785a75cede808d00a906b15882d3a51c22ee OP_EQUAL
address
3AEgwUq9WmJhs1JcM42Zvcd1ZHV42ATpJb
transaction
150c869af1bebb8aed780fcd347caa2d328836a9caeddc8525fce54b3d412aaf
confirmations
40224
spent
true